Volunteer Opportunities
At Natchitoches Regional Medical Center, community members give generously of their time and talents to help the hospital and its facilities better serve patients, residents and families.
Volunteers provide many services including assisting administrative departments, transporter services, special projects on the nursing floors, customer experience improvement and more.
Volunteers also help in the nursery, surgery and intensive care waiting rooms, and they assist patients with directions, help staff the front desk, help patients with wheelchairs, and more. Wherever you look, you will see men and women volunteering and providing the hospital with important services.
All volunteers must complete an application, be current in immunizations, submit to a thorough background check and attend an orientation session to learn about the hospital’s policies including patient safety.

NRMC Guild
The Natchitoches Regional Medical Center Guild (sometimes called the Auxiliary) has a long history at NRMC. Through the years, the Guild has tirelessly raised funds to support the hospital.
The Guild’s gift shop, located in the main lobby, opens Monday through Friday from 8 a.m. to 3 p.m., and the proceeds raised from the gift shop as well as other fundraisers are donated to the hospital for important projects. Through the years, the Guild has helped with costs associated with special equipment, signage, and other needs. They also sponsored the Community Health Needs Assessment Summit which brought together community leaders to discuss the health needs of our parish.
The Guild also raises funds through periodic jewelry sales, book fairs, and more.

Patient and Family Advisory Council
The Patient and Family Advisory Council, is a team of patient and family members who collaborate with NRMC representatives to enhance the services and care delivered.
A patient and family adviser is someone who:
- Wants to help improve the quality of our hospital system’s care for all patients and family members.
- Gives feedback to the hospital based on his or her own experiences as a patient or family member.
- Helps us plan changes to improve how we take care of patients.
- Works with the hospital for either short or long- term commitments, depending on the project.
- Volunteers his or her time, typically 1.5 – to two hours, one weeknight, every other month.
Patient and family advisers provide a voice that represents all patients and families of patients who receive care at NRMC. They partner with hospital staff and administrators to help improve the quality of our hospital’s care for all patients and family members.
